在移动互联网持续深化的背景下,小程序AR正逐渐从概念走向落地,成为连接虚拟与现实的重要桥梁。尤其在文旅、零售等场景中,小程序AR凭借其轻量化部署、无需下载安装的优势,展现出巨大的应用潜力。然而,许多开发者在实际推进过程中仍面临框架搭建不稳、渲染性能不足、设备兼容性差等问题,导致用户体验断层,项目难以规模化推广。如何构建一个既高效又稳定的底层架构,同时融入地域文化元素以增强用户情感共鸣,已成为当前小程序AR开发的核心挑战。
核心技术认知:小程序AR与传统AR的本质差异
不同于传统的AR应用依赖独立客户端和复杂的本地资源加载,小程序AR依托微信生态的开放能力,通过WebGL与ARKit/ARCore的轻量级集成,在浏览器环境中实现空间感知与三维渲染。这种“即用即走”的特性极大降低了用户使用门槛,但同时也对框架设计提出了更高要求——必须在有限的运行环境下完成高帧率渲染、精准定位追踪与实时交互响应。若框架设计粗放,极易出现卡顿、漂移甚至崩溃,直接影响内容传播力与转化效果。因此,理解小程序AR的技术边界,是构建高质量应用的第一步。
性能瓶颈与优化盲区:开发者常忽视的细节
尽管主流开发工具已提供基础支持,但在真实项目中,性能问题依然频发。例如,部分团队为追求视觉效果,盲目引入高精度3D模型或复杂动画,导致加载时间过长,尤其在低端机型上表现尤为明显。此外,未对摄像头权限、环境光检测、平面识别等关键流程进行异步处理,也会造成主线程阻塞。更值得警惕的是,多数开发者忽略了对不同安卓版本与iOS机型的差异化适配策略,使得同一应用在部分设备上完全无法启动。这些看似“小问题”的累积,最终演变为用户流失的主因。

轻量化框架架构:兼顾稳定与流畅的实践路径
针对上述痛点,我们提出一套适用于小程序AR的轻量化框架架构。该架构采用模块化设计,将核心功能拆分为独立组件:空间定位引擎、动态资源加载器、交互事件分发器与渲染缓存管理器。通过引入懒加载机制与对象池技术,有效减少内存占用;结合Web Workers实现后台计算任务隔离,避免影响主界面流畅度。更重要的是,框架内置自适应分辨率与画质调节策略,可根据设备性能自动切换渲染模式,确保在低配手机上也能保持稳定运行。这一架构已在多个西安本地文旅项目中验证,平均启动时间缩短40%,帧率波动控制在±5%以内。
西安元素的视觉融合:打造具有辨识度的文化表达
作为十三朝古都,西安拥有丰富的历史文化资源,唐风建筑、秦腔脸谱、碑林拓片、兵马俑造型等元素极具视觉张力。在小程序AR的设计实践中,我们尝试将这些符号转化为可交互的数字资产。例如,在某景区导览小程序中,用户通过手机扫描地面,即可触发虚拟唐长安城的全息复原,配合背景音效中的古琴与吟唱,瞬间营造出穿越时空的沉浸感。另一案例中,利用秦腔脸谱作为角色表情系统,用户可通过手势变化激活不同情绪状态,增强了趣味性与参与感。这类设计不仅提升了内容辨识度,也使小程序AR从“技术展示”升维为“文化叙事”,显著提高分享率与停留时长。
落地难题应对:降低用户认知门槛与设备适配成本
尽管技术框架趋于成熟,但在实际推广中,仍需关注用户行为习惯。许多中老年用户对“扫码启动AR”存在误解,误以为需要下载额外程序。为此,我们在引导流程中加入可视化提示动画,并通过语音播报辅助说明,有效降低操作错误率。对于设备兼容性问题,建议采用“降级策略”——当检测到不支持AR功能的设备时,自动切换至2D互动模式,保留核心体验而不中断服务。同时,提前在微信开发者工具中进行多机型真机测试,覆盖主流品牌与系统版本,可大幅减少上线后的报错率。
在小程序AR的探索之路上,技术架构与文化表达缺一不可。只有当底层框架足够稳健,视觉语言足够本土,才能真正实现从“能用”到“好用”的跨越。尤其在西安这样的历史文化重镇,小程序AR不仅是技术工具,更是连接过去与未来的媒介。我们始终致力于为开发者提供可复用的解决方案,帮助其快速构建高性能、高传播性的沉浸式应用。无论是文旅导览、品牌营销还是商业展示,小程序AR都能在合适的设计与架构支撑下,释放最大价值。如需获取定制化开发支持或深度设计协作,欢迎联系17723342546,我们将为您提供从需求分析到上线维护的一站式服务。
欢迎微信扫码咨询